Virginia Average Weekly Wage By County in 2016 Q1
Updated on January 22, 2025.

According to the data from the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, the average weekly wage for Virginia in 2016 Q1 was $1,056. Among all Virginia counties, Goochland County had the highest average weekly wage ($1,984), followed by Arlington County ($1,730), and Surry County ($1,679). On the other hand, Patrick County had the lowest average weekly wage ($492), followed by Mathews County ($504), and Appomattox County ($525).
